Part 2: Riddles to Crack
Each riddle holds the key to its answer—think creatively to solve these linguistic puzzles!
- Riddle:
I’m not alive, but I can grow.
I don’t have lungs, but I need air.
What am I?
(Answer: Fire) - Riddle:
The more you take, the more you leave behind.
What am I?
(Answer: Footsteps) - Riddle:
I speak without a mouth and hear without ears.
I have no body, but I come alive with wind.
What am I?
(Answer: An echo)
